| Hi guys currently I'm trying to upgrade my RAM. I currently have MSI 865PE Neo2 Mobo - Supports Dual Channel DDR 400/333/266 memory interface. Intel 2.8 Ghz 256 x 2 DDR PC3200 OCZ Ram (Dual Channel) eVGA 6600GT 128mb I want to upgrade my RAM, I'm planning on adding 512 x 2 DDR PC3200 to make it 1.5gb of Ram. But I've heard that having different memory of RAM as Dual Channel is unstable. So should I just buy 512 x 2 DDR PC3200 and replace my 256 x 2 DDR OCZ? Or adding it up to make 1.5gig is still stable? And is there any other specs I need to worry about (matching) when buying Dual Channel Ram? Thanks! |

| Wizard Techie | if you have 4 slots, then 2x256 and 2x512 will still run in dual channel, providing they are all in the correct corresponding slots. That's exactly what I'm doing right now in my PC Ryan
